Reliable Cleansing and Disinfecting Techniques

Applying detailed cleansing and disinfecting approaches is essential in ensuring the full removal of mold spores post-remediation. After eliminating noticeable mold and mildew growth, it is essential to clean all surface areas in the damaged area to remove any type of remaining mold and mildew spores. One reliable method is making use of a mix of water and cleaning agent to scrub surfaces strongly. This assists in literally removing the mold and mildew and its spores from the surfaces. After cleaning, decontaminating the location is critical to kill any kind of remaining mold and mildew spores and protect against regrowth. A remedy of water and bleach or a commercial anti-bacterial specifically created for mold removal can be put on the cleaned up surface areas. It is essential to allow the anti-bacterial sit for the suggested dwell time to guarantee its performance. Additionally, utilizing HEPA vacuum cleaners and air scrubbers can even more help in removing air-borne mold particles, supplying an extra detailed cleaning process. By adhering to these thorough cleansing and decontaminating approaches, you can successfully clear the room of mold and mildew contamination and advertise a much healthier interior setting.
